This Rocky Road Fudge recipe has got to be the EASIEST fudge recipe in the history of the world.

This is perfect for gift giving at the holidays. Everyone I know loves it, and it only requires 5 ingredients — dry roasted peanuts, sweetened condensed milk, semi-sweet chocolate chips, mini-marshmallows, and butter.

Best of all, you can make it all in one big pot on the stovetop. Just melt the butter and chocolate chips, add the sweetened condensed milk, and mix it all together. Then remove it from the heat, stir in the marshmallows and peanuts, and you’re done! Spread it in a pan, and refrigerate for a few hours until it’s hard enough to cut.

Rocky Road Fudge
Prep time:
Total time:
Serves: 20
Ingredients
  • 2 cups (12 oz) semisweet chocolate chips
  • 1 (14-oz) can Eagle Brand sweetened condensed milk
  • 2 Tbsp butter
  • 3 cups salted dry roasted peanuts
  • 1 (10-oz) package mini marshmallows
Instructions
  1. In a saucepan, combine chips, milk, and butter.
  2. Cook and stir over medium heat until chips are melted and mixtures is smooth.
  3. Remove from heat; stir in peanuts and marshmallows.
  4. Spread into greased 13x9x2 baking pan; refrigerate until firm.
  5. Cut into squares and package them up for holiday gift giving! (Don’t forget to save a few for you!)
